Output 0185e26ac65de6109b9367ef2ef275f420510de32f43beef68a42716c74e4f6a:0

value
55954666
script pubkey
OP_0 OP_PUSHBYTES_20 4dc63c4162295222f0d17d7ee64b748dcd64105b
address
tb1qfhrrcstz99fz9ux304lwvjm53hxkgyzm57ervx
transaction
0185e26ac65de6109b9367ef2ef275f420510de32f43beef68a42716c74e4f6a
confirmations
111788
spent
true